Notice Title
Neurodivergent Services (2 Lots)
Notice Description
Lot 1: Neurodivergent Hub The Council is commissioning a twice weekly peer led hub specifically for neurodivergent adults (e.g. autistic adults and adults with ADHD) which provides information and peer support and enhances social and communication skills, independence and resilience for adults and young people aged 16+ in Calderdale The service will engage with people with neurodivergent conditions e.g. Autism and ADHD who may be vulnerable and isolated within the Calderdale community and provide them with the specific support, strategies, guidance and information to enable them to make healthier lifestyle choices and decisions, build resilience and enable them to better manage life experiences. The successful Tenderer will be encouraged to be innovative, cost effective and incorporate added value when delivering the service The key aims of this service are to provide a preventative service for young people (16+) and adults with Autism or ADHD who have little or no formal support, and to improve outcomes for service users. Lot 2: Neurodivergent Employment Service The Council is commissioning a weekly employment service specifically for neurodivergent adults which provides information, guidance and support to adults with Autism, ADHD and other neurodivergent conditions in Calderdale who are working towards gaining paid or voluntary work The service will engage with neurodivergent people without a learning disability who may be vulnerable and isolated within the Calderdale community and will provide them with the specific support, strategies, guidance and information to enable them to enhance their employability in order to apply for voluntary or paid work. The needs of individuals will vary from starting to look at which areas of work interest them and fit their skill set, to applying for their next job.
